Unlock instant, AI-driven research and patent intelligence for your innovation.

Large number factorization method and system

A technology of factorization and factoring, which is applied in the field of large number factorization methods and systems, can solve problems such as high cost and time-consuming calculations, and achieve fast, efficient solutions and high efficiency

Pending Publication Date: 2022-04-29
SHENZHEN Y& D ELECTRONICS CO LTD
View PDF0 Cites 0 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

[0004] The technical problem to be solved by the present invention is to construct a large number factorization method and system for the above-mentioned defects of the prior art, by converting the large number factorization task that is extremely complex in calculation, costly and time-consuming, into a high-efficiency, high-speed Fast table lookup tasks can provide a new and efficient solution for large number factorization

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Large number factorization method and system
  • Large number factorization method and system
  • Large number factorization method and system

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0049] In order to make the object, technical solution and advantages of the present invention clearer, the present invention will be further described in detail below in conjunction with the accompanying drawings and embodiments. It should be understood that the specific embodiments described here are only used to explain the present invention, not to limit the present invention.

[0050] After analyzing the nature of large composite numbers that are easy to construct but difficult to decompose, the present invention gets rid of the fixed thinking of traditional decomposition algorithms, adopts a retrograde thinking method, and first constructs a list of large composite numbers by multiplying the smallest prime number in pairs. The row and column values ​​of the list correspond to the prime numbers formed, and the content in the table is the composite value corresponding to the product of the prime numbers. Since the number of prime numbers is infinite, this table is in a sta...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

The invention relates to a large number factorization method and system. The method comprises the following steps: continuously creating a large composite number table, wherein the large composite number table comprises a first prime number factor, a second prime number factor and a product of the first prime number factor and the second prime number factor; and searching a to-be-decomposed composite number in the product of the large composite number table, and taking the first prime number factor and the second prime number factor corresponding to the product as a decomposition result of the to-be-decomposed composite number. According to the method, the large number factorization task which is extremely complex in calculation and high in cost and time consumption is converted into the table look-up task which is high in efficiency and speed, and a brand-new efficient solution can be provided for large number factorization.

Description

technical field [0001] The present invention relates to the field of large number calculation, more specifically, relates to a large number factorization method and system. Background technique [0002] RSA is currently the most important public key algorithm, which is widely used in various fields. The principle of RSA is that, according to number theory, it is relatively simple to find two large prime numbers, but it is extremely difficult to factorize their product, so the product can be made public as an encryption key. Therefore, the security of RSA depends on the difficulty of decomposing large numbers. In the past ten years, in order to ensure security, the binary length of the RSA key has increased from 512 bits to the current 1024, and the high level of security requires the use of 2048 bits. [0003] So far, the factorization problem of large numbers has not been proved to be solvable in polynomial time, nor has it been proved that RSA deciphering is as difficult...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
Patent Type & Authority Applications(China)
IPC IPC(8): G06F7/72
CPCG06F7/72
Inventor 戚建淮成飏何润民孙丁郑伟范唐娟刘建辉崔宸
Owner SHENZHEN Y& D ELECTRONICS CO LTD